Horizontal Equivalent is the actual distance between two points on two contour lines. Slope of the land is known as the gradient. It can be expressed as. Gradient = Vertical Interval/Horizontal Equivalent.Jan 28, 2015

What is contour interval and horizontal equivalent?

Contour Interval: The constant vertical distance between two consecutive contours is called the contour interval. Horizontal Equivalent: The horizontal distance between any two adjacent contours is called as horizontal equivalent. while the horizontal equivalent is variable and depends upon the slope of the ground.

What is vertical equivalent?

The difference in height between two adjacent contour lines is known as the Vertical Interval (V.I.). Whereas the distance between any two adjacent contour lines is called the Horizontal Equivalent (H.E.).

Why is the horizontal equivalent not constant?

The horizontal equivalent is the horizontal distance between any two continuous contour lines. It is not constant and varies according to the steepness of the ground. For steep slopes, the horizontal equivalent is narrow while for flatter slopes it is wide.

What is horizontal distance in surveying?

In plane surveying, the distance between two points means the horizontal distance. If the points are at different elevations, then the distance is the horizontal length between plumb lines at the points.

What are the different methods of contouring?

There are two methods of contour surveying: Direct method. Indirect method....Indirect Method of ContouringMethod of squares.Method of cross-section.Radial line method.

What are the different types of contour lines?

There are 3 kinds of contour lines you'll see on a map: intermediate, index, and supplementary. Index lines are the thickest contour lines and are usually labeled with a number at one point along the line.

What is contour interval in contouring?

It is the difference in elevation between two consecutive contour lines. For a contour map, the contour interval is always constant.
